5th Australian Light Horse Regiment, Embarkation Roll, 11th Reinforcements Hawkes Bay Group
Topic: AIF - 2B - 5 LHR

5th LHR, AIF

5th Australian Light Horse Regiment

Embarkation Roll, 11th Reinforcements Hawkes Bay Group


SS Hawkes Bay

 

5th Australian Light Horse Regiment, AIF, 11th Reinforcements Hawkes Bay Group, embarked from Sydney, New South Wales on board SS Hawkes Bay 21 October 1915.

The SS Hawkes Bay was built at Sunderland in 1891 and weighed 4,583 tons. It was owned by the TYSER LINE (G.D.TYSER & CO.)

Embarkation Roll

 

1737 Private Arthur ADAMS, a 20 year old Labourer from Grafton, New South Wales.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 9 February 1919.

1733 Private Walter Frederick AMOS, a 20 year old Carpenter from South Grafton, New South Wales. He enlisted on 17 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 29 January 1919.

 

Second Lieutenant George Waverley BATHURST, a 39 year old Mechanical Engineer from Melbourne, Victoria. He enlisted on 14 June 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 1 July 1916.

1702 Private Edwin BELL, a 20 year old Labourer from Kangaroo Pt,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 27 June 1919.

1731 Private Frederick BOOTH, a 21 year old Labourer from Hemmant, Queensland. He enlisted on 30 August 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 2 September 1916.

1727 Private John James BRADLEY, a 29 year old Labourer from Roma, Queensland. He enlisted on 23 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 2 January 1919.

1729 Private Hugh BUCHANAN, a 19 year old Labourer from Copmanhurst, New South Wales. He enlisted on 30 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 25 March 1919.

1688 Private Stanley BURROWS, a 21 year old Clerk from Ipswich, Queensland. He enlisted on 20 July 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 5 July 1919.

1693 Private Charles Sebastian CARBERRY, a 23 year old Carter from Rosalie, Queensland. He enlisted on 17 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 27 June 1919.

 

1736 Private James Thomas CLANCY, a 22 year old Labourer from Nambour, Queensland. He enlisted on 19 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 26 July 1919.

1692 Private Albert CLARK, a 20 year old Dairy farmer from Clayfield,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and subsequently Died of Disease, 27 January 1916.

1694 Private James COOK, an 18 year old Labourer from East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and subsequently was Killed in Action, 19 October 1917.

1689 Private John Ashley COOPER, a 21 year old Labourer from Gayndah,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 19 April 1919.

1398 Private Edward Arnold CORNELL, a 22 year old Farmer from Goombungee,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 July 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 23 December 1918.

1725 Private David COULTER, a 21 year old Jeweller from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 12 June 1919.

1691 Private John CREW, a 27 year old Miner from Mt Morgan, Queensland. He enlisted on 25 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 27 June 1919.

 

1734 Private Hugh DOLAN, a 35 year old Labourer from Clifton, Queensland. He enlisted on 19 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 12 April 1919.

1695 Private Frank Charles DUCE, an 18 year old Carter from Woolloongabba, Queensland. He enlisted on 20 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 January 1919.

 

1698 Private William Thomas FITZGERALD, a 21 year old Storeman from Hendra, Queensland. He enlisted on 17 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 26 July 1919.

1697 Private John FLYNN, a 23 year old Miner from Mt Morgan,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 15 May 1919.

 

1700 Private Newbury Hine GREEN, a 20 year old Labourer from Cloncurry,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 27 April 1919.

1699 Private William Arthur GRIMLEY, a 21 year old Draper from Breakfast Creek, Queensland. He enlisted on 17 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 22 August 1919.

 

1739 Private Ernest Harold HALLIGAN, a 21 year old Lithographer from Coorparoo,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 13 April 1919.

1686 Acting Sergeant David Lewin HOPPER, a 22 year old Engine foreman from Bell,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 June 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 26 September 1917.

1726 Private James Alfred HUBBARD, a 32 year old Horse breaker from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 30 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 26 July 1919.

 

1687 Acting Corporal John KELLEHER, a 24 year old Farmer from Pomona, Queensland. He enlisted on 4 June 1915; and subsequently Died of Wounds, 9 November 1917.

1704 Private Alexander Matthew KELLY, a 21 year old Roo Shooter from Murarrie, Queensland. He enlisted on 20 August 1915; and subsequently was Discharged, 27 September 1919.

 

1705 Private James John LAWLOR, a 21 year old Labourer from Breakfast Creek, Queensland. He enlisted on 21 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 20 July 1919.

1740 Private John LEE, a 42 year old Stockman from Charleville, Queensland. He enlisted on 27 February 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 1 February 1918.

 

1707 Private John James MARSH, a 21 year old Grocer from Hemet,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and subsequently Died of Wounds, 6 November 1917.

1710 Private John MARSHALL, a 26 year old Driver from Rosalie, Queensland. He enlisted on 19 August 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 30 August 1918.

1709 Private Duncan McDIARMID, a 21 year old Trapper from Tingalpa, Queensland. He enlisted on 20 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

1708 Private James Clyde McGRATH, an 18 year old Labourer from Cooroy, Queensland. He enlisted on 23 August 1915; and subsequently was Killed in Action, 22 October 1918.

1741 Private Robert McWILLIAM, a 27 year old Labourer from Ormiston, Queensland. He enlisted on 7 September 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 5 September 1919.

1711 Private Herbert John MULQUEENEY, a 28 year old Farmer from Bell, Queensland. He enlisted on 22 July 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 15 November 1918.

 

1712 Private Walter Albert OXFORD, a 21 year old Painter from South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 20 January 1916.

 

1714 Private George Alfred PAYNTER, a 21 year old Labourer from Toowoomba, Queensland. He enlisted on 14 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 3 May 1919.

1713 Private John Vincent PARSONS, a 25 year old Carpenter from Morningside,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 6 May 1919.

1735 Private Frederick Freestone PHILLIPS, a 20 year old Farmer from Freestone,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

1730 Private Cedric Belford PRATT, a 21 year old Carpenter from Grafton, New South Wales.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

 

1716 Private George Wyvern RAFF, a 34 year old Sawyer from Nundah, Queensland. He enlisted on 20 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

1724 Private James Henry REYNOLDS, a 26 year old Labourer from Barcaldine, Queensland. He enlisted on 14 August 1915; and subsequently Died of Wounds, 7 May 1918.

1715 Private George Herbert RILEY, a 28 year old Harness maker from Charleville, Queensland. He enlisted on 19 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 29 April 1919.

1717 Private George ROSE, a 36 year old Printer from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 11 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 15 May 1919.

 

1720 Private Alfred SPEERS, a 21 year old Saddler from Balmain, New South Wales. He enlisted on 21 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

1718 Private Frank STAPLES, a 31 year old Station hand from Charleville, Queensland. He enlisted on 17 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 13 March 1919.

1719 Private Ernest Lawrence SULLIVAN, a 25 year old Butcher from Bundarra, New South Wales. He enlisted on 20 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

 

1728 Private William Alexander TOCHER, a 20 year old Labourer from South Grafton, New South Wales. He enlisted on 30 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 28 June 1919.

1732 Private Percy Thomas TOSI, a 22 year old Carter from Longlands, East Brisbane, Queensland. He enlisted on 16 August 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 10 June 1916.

 

1722 Private Thomas Percy UHLMANN, a 23 year old Butcher from Hemmant, Queensland. He enlisted on 18 August 1915; and subsequently Returned to Australia, 15 February 1918.

 

1723 Private Samuel WILSON, a 27 year old Stable boy from Breakfast Creek, Queensland. He enlisted on 23 August 1915; and at the conclusion of the war Returned to Australia, 17 July 1919.
